For the last few weeks, Ms. Martin’s 2nd Class have been participating in the Junior Achievement Programme. The Junior Achievement Programme involves business volunteers coming to schools, to inspire and motivate children to make the most of their education. Our business volunteer was Mairead Slevin and we thoroughly enjoyed her lessons every week. Mairead works with a pharmaceutical company called “Janssen”. We really enjoyed learning about her job.

The theme for each lesson was “Our Community”. During these lessons, the children learned about the many different jobs it takes to make a community work. We also learned a little about the government and the voting system in Ireland. We even elected our own Mayor!
